Keyless entry
Keyless entry systems have numerous advantages for vehicles. It can improve security of vehicles decrease maintenance costs, and increase convenience. It can also help businesses manage their fleets of vehicles more efficiently. These benefits are only realized only if the key fob been programmed correctly. This process can be difficult and time-consuming, but it is essential for the safety of the driver and passengers. It is recommended to hire a key programmer who is a professional in Jurupa Valley who has the knowledge and experience to accomplish this task.
The car key fobs contain transponders, which emit radio frequencies that contain the digital identity code of the vehicle. The code is transmitted from the key fob to a receiver within the vehicle, which recognizes it as the right key. A keyless entry system is used to lock and unlock a vehicle. It may also enable remote start, among other options.
As opposed to traditional keys remotes with keyless entry systems are designed to be impossible to pick and more difficult to take. They send a unique signal to identify the key to the PASE module. The module then reads the data and unlocks the doors. However the technology isn't impervious to theft, and criminals can manipulate the signal and manipulate the PASE module into reading the incorrect ID.
